Está usted en Indice > Construcción > Lenguajes > Java > Lecciones y Paso a Paso > Firma digital de un Applet en Java
Construcción
Maletín
Utilidades
Cursos
Promoción
Rentabilidad
Zona Novatos
Foros
Acceso a tu cuenta

Firma digital de un applet en Java (2)

Luego el nombre de la provincia. Por ejemplo: Madrid

  • El código de país en dos letras: ES

  • Nos pide confirmar los datos

  • Veremos que esta generando la clave y un certificado auto firmado ( SHA1WithDSA ).

    Nos pide la contraseña para el alias 'autentia' que acabamos de crear.

    Y ya está. En este punto tenemos un certificado firmado por nosotros mismos.

    2.2. Firmar el jar

    Ahora vamos a firmar el applet. Recordar que tenemos que meter nuestro applet dentro de un jar, y será este jar el que firmemos con:

    jarsigner.exe miapplet.jar autentia -verbose

    Esto sobreescribirá 'miapplet.jar' y añadirá un par de ficheros en el directorio META-INF, con la información de la firma.

    La opción -verbose es para que el comando nos de más información sobre lo que va haciendo.

    Al ejecutar el comando nos pedirá la clave para acceder al almacén de claves.

    Conclusiones

    Como se puede ver es muy sencillo generar nuestros propios certificados, y firmar nuestros jar.




    Autor: Alejandro Pérez García
    http://www.autentia.com

    Usuarios que han visto este tema también han visto...

    - Cast & Performance en Java
    - Errores comunes en la programación con Java
    - Firma digital de un applet en Java
    - Paso de parámetros a funciones Java
    - Traducir nombres de host a direcciones de Internet


    Versión imprimible - Versión imprimible de este documento
    Enviar e-mail - Enviar por e-mail este documento
    Publicidad






    Cursos de Community Manager

    Información legal | Política de Privacidad | Contacte con nosotros

    Otro proyecto de Factoría de Internet. Copyright© 2003-2011 Factoría de Internet S.L.. Todos los derechos reservados.


    Página generada el 25-05-2012 a las 20:56:58